Output 8ec8978904c73e79cb0644f1718b9339a760e5d080624f120aceb4cc356e0757:15

value
79440508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c235201e453266fdf43666cbb68429a5f82641e OP_EQUAL
address
MATwTuFr1MNrmymCu4m1xZiGo1hvvy3Pxr
transaction
8ec8978904c73e79cb0644f1718b9339a760e5d080624f120aceb4cc356e0757
spent
true